... Read moreTaking on a reading challenge like the Three Book Challenge is a fantastic way to revitalize your love for books and diversify your reading habits. This challenge encourages readers to engage with three different categories: books recently read, books you really want to read, and books you'd love to experience again for the first time. The ACOTAR (A Court of Thorns and Roses) series by Sarah J. Maas is a popular favorite for good reason. Its blend of fantasy, romance, and strong character development captivates many readers, making it a great pick for those wanting an immersive experience. If you enjoy this series, you might also appreciate other New York Times bestsellers like Rebecca Yarros’ "The Last Letter" and Taylor Jenkins Reid’s "Maybe in Another Life," both praised for their emotional depth and compelling storytelling.
